Abstract :
The authors analyze the validity of the pessimistic views of M.L. Minsky and S.A. Papert (Perceptrons: An Intro. to Comput. Geom., MIT Press, Cambridge, MA, 1969) on the possibility of training multi-layer perceptrons. In particular, they show that it was possible, using the simplex algorithm of J.A. Nelder and R. Mead (Comput. Journ., vol.8, pp.308-13, 1965), to train these networks at the time of writing of Minsky´s and Papert´s book, and demonstrate this experimentally on three real-life classification problems, each involving a specific data set.
